Samantha Costa, community engagement coordinator for the Santa Barbara Police Department, told the Fire and Police Commission on July 24 that the department launched a Blue Envelope program in February 2025 and has dramatically increased outreach events this year.

Costa said the Blue Envelope program "is designed to serve as an enhanced communication awareness tool" to help officers and community members who have difficulties with communication. "How it works is we provide these blue envelope branded products, everyday wear items that interested parties can obtain from us," she said.
